Visual Inspection: Under standardized lighting, trained QC staff check for cracks, chipping, inclusions, pores, or oxidation.
Image Measurement System: High-res cameras and algorithms conduct non-contact 2D measurements, especially for complex or irregular shapes, ensuring efficiency and objectivity in mass production.
Automated Intelligent Inspection: High-speed cameras with AI algorithms detect and reject defects (e.g., cracks, scratches, discoloration) and dimensional anomalies, improving yield and reducing human error.

Magnetic Flux Consistency Test: Fluxmeters or Hall-effect testers measure magnetic flux across batches to ensure uniform performance in end-user applications.
Reliability Test
Impact & Vibration Test: Simulates shipping and usage conditions to ensure operational stability.
Constant Temperature & Humidity Test: Performed under 85°C and 85% RH for 96–500 hours. Performance and appearance are compared before and after testing.

Q: How to choose the correct magnetization direction?
Axial Magnetization: Magnetic lines flow through thickness — best for concentrated fields
Radial Magnetization: Magnetic lines radiate outward — for uniform field distribution
Multipole Magnetization: Multiple poles along circumference — for complex fields (e.g., motors, sensors)
Q: What is the maximum working temperature of magnet?
Standard N-series: up to 80°C
High-temp grades (SH/UH/EH): up to 150°C–230°C
Dysprosium-enriched formulations can further enhance temperature resistance

Handle gently: Avoid impacts/drops (brittle material).
Prevent pinching: Slide magnets apart—do not pry.
Polarity check: Install correctly to avoid malfunctions.
Avoid moisture/acids: Store in dry, mild environments.
Keep away from sensitive devices: Hard drives, IC cards, pacemakers, etc.
